What are Medical Physics Residents?

Medical Physics Residents are individuals who have completed graduate education in medical physics and are undergoing clinical training, typically in a hospital or cancer treatment center. Their residency programs are designed to provide hands-on experience in applying physics principles to medicine, particularly in diagnosing and treating diseases like cancer. Residents work under the supervision of certified medical physicists, gaining proficiency in areas such as radiation therapy, imaging, and safety protocols. Completion of a medical physics residency is often required for board certification and a career as a clinical medical physicist.

What are some common challenges faced by Medical Physics Residents during their training?

Medical Physics Residents often encounter challenges balancing clinical responsibilities with ongoing learning and research. Adjusting to the fast-paced healthcare environment, mastering new technologies, and staying updated with evolving safety protocols can be demanding. Collaboration with medical staff, radiation oncologists, and technologists is essential, which requires strong communication and teamwork skills. Additionally, residents must prepare for board exams while gaining hands-on experience, making effective time management crucial for success.

What are the key skills and qualifications needed to thrive as a Medical Physics Resident, and why are they important?

To thrive as a Medical Physics Resident, you need a solid background in physics or medical physics, typically with a master's or PhD in the field and completion of a CAMPEP-accredited program. Familiarity with radiation therapy equipment, treatment planning systems, and dosimetry tools is essential, as well as knowledge of safety regulations. Strong analytical skills, attention to detail, and effective communication make a resident stand out in this role. These qualities are crucial for ensuring accurate patient treatment, maintaining safety standards, and collaborating with multidisciplinary clinical teams.

What is the difference between Medical Physics Resident vs Medical Physicist?

AspectMedical Physics ResidentMedical Physicist
CredentialsTypically enrolled in a residency program, often with a master's or doctoral degree in medical physicsHolds certification from bodies like the ABR, with completed residency and licensure
Work EnvironmentTraining setting within hospitals or clinics, supervised by experienced physicistsIndependent practitioner working in clinical, research, or academic settings
Employer & IndustryHospitals, cancer centers, academic institutions during trainingHospitals, clinics, research institutions, or private practices post-certification
Search & Comparison IntentUnderstanding training roles and pathwaysClarifying professional responsibilities and qualifications

The main difference is that a Medical Physics Resident is in training, gaining hands-on experience under supervision, while a Medical Physicist is a fully qualified professional responsible for clinical tasks, treatment planning, and quality assurance in medical settings.

The Role
Clinical Responsibilities (65% of time)
As a Radiation Physics Medical Physicist, you will be the backbone of our clinical physics program:
• Consult with radiation oncologists, dosimetrists, and radiation therapists on treatment planning and clinical problem-solving
• Perform comprehensive patient-specific dose calculations and treatment plan verification for all assigned patients
• Conduct weekly quality assurance checks on dose calculations and treatment plans
• Lead quality assurance programs for all radiation-producing equipment, performing routine calibrations, safety checks, and performance testing
• Perform specialized dosimetry for advanced treatment techniques including IMRT/VMAT QA, brachytherapy, and in-vivo dosimetry
• Ensure compliance with all radiation safety standards and regulatory requirements
• Support cutting-edge clinical applications and special procedures
Clinical Development (20% of time)
Drive innovation and excellence in clinical physics:
• Participate in selection, evaluation, and acceptance testing of new radiation therapy equipment
• Lead commissioning and implementation of new radiotherapy technologies
• Develop and validate new clinical procedures for treatment planning and delivery
• Provide clinical support for pilot programs before general clinical release
• Stay at the forefront of radiotherapy physics with emerging technologies
Education & Mentorship (10% of time)
Shape the next generation of medical physicists:
• Mentor and teach CAMPEP-accredited medical physics residents in the clinical physics program
• Provide instruction to graduate students during clinical rotations
• Contribute to curriculum development and course instruction
• Demonstrate excellence as a clinical role model and trusted advisor
Professional Development (5% of time)
Maintain your expertise and grow professionally:
• Pursue continuing education and maintain board certification
• Share knowledge through in-services, journal club presentations, and training
• Engage with national professional societies and organizations
• Stay current with advances in radiation physics
Required Qualifications
• Master's Degree (MS) in Therapeutic Radiological Physics from an AAPM/CAMPEP-accredited program
• Board Certified or Board Eligible in Therapeutic Radiological Physics (ABR or ABMP)
• Minimum 2 years of clinical experience in radiation physics
• Excellent verbal and written communication skills in English
• Ability to function effectively in a collaborative team environment
